The Quest of the Tiger Woman
(Millennium, 1994)
™ and ©1994 Donald Marquez
The Quest of the Tiger Woman takes place in a post-apocalyptic world after most of the Earth’s population fled to the stars. As a result, a computer genius who calls himself “Zeus” is free to conduct large-scale experiments in creation and destiny and repopulates Earth with genetically altered versions of characters from Greek mythology.
But one woman, raised by Tigers, has no fear of gods. The Tiger Woman goes to Zeus to ask for his help in killing a murderous Gryphon. The scientist is intrigued by this bold intruder and sees her as the means to gather a tissue sample from the Gryphon, so that he might complete the ultimate creation—a Phoenix. This man/god should have known, however, that the Tiger Woman is no easily controlled beast or servant. Armed with Zeus’s armor and a genetically created Pegasus, she does battle with the Gryphon—and in so doing burns down Olympus.
